Along the river during the qingming festival, detail of the original version showing wooden bridge. Object Type: panoramic painting, handscroll. Genre: landscape painting. Date: 1085. Place of creation: Northern Song dynasty. Dimensions: height: 24.8 cm (9.7 in) ; width: 528 cm (17.3 ft). Medium: silk. Collection: The Palace Museum.
